Why plugins keep load/unload/deactivate/activate every few minutes? #10923
barrowkwan
started this conversation in
General
Replies: 0 comments
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Uh oh!
There was an error while loading. Please reload this page.
-
I created a docker image from master branch and deployed in kubernetes. I didn't seem to see this behavior in the over 0.x version.
However this plugin load/unload/deactivate/active, keep showing up very few minutes in the log. did I miss something when installing the latest version.
2025-11-26 16:46:24,853 INFO {'event': 'Collecting plugins', 'ip': '10.30.62.101', 'user_id': 1, 'request_id': '5cbc2ce19d1431b02a83262ba6817da5', 'timestamp': '2025-11-27T00:46:24.853793Z', 'logger': 'inventree', 'level': 'info'}
2025-11-27T00:46:24.854652Z [info ] Added plugin directory: '/home/inventree/data/plugins' as '/home/inventree/data/plugins' [inventree] ip=10.30.62.101 request_id=5cbc2ce19d1431b02a83262ba6817da5 user_id=1
2025-11-26 16:46:24,854 INFO {'event': "Added plugin directory: '/home/inventree/data/plugins' as '/home/inventree/data/plugins'", 'ip': '10.30.62.101', 'user_id': 1, 'request_id': '5cbc2ce19d1431b02a83262ba6817da5', 'timestamp': '2025-11-27T00:46:24.854652Z', 'logger': 'inventree', 'level': 'info'}
2025-11-27T00:46:24.855293Z [debug ] Loading plugins from directory 'plugin.builtin' [inventree] ip=10.30.62.101 request_id=5cbc2ce19d1431b02a83262ba6817da5 user_id=1
2025-11-26 16:46:24,855 DEBUG {'event': "Loading plugins from directory 'plugin.builtin'", 'ip': '10.30.62.101', 'user_id': 1, 'request_id': '5cbc2ce19d1431b02a83262ba6817da5', 'timestamp': '2025-11-27T00:46:24.855293Z', 'logger': 'inventree', 'level': 'debug'}
2025-11-27T00:46:24.864079Z [debug ] Loading plugins from directory 'plugin.samples' [inventree] ip=10.30.62.101 request_id=c5ce833c05e8efa690ab36ba5e1adafc user_id=1
2025-11-26 16:46:24,864 DEBUG {'event': "Loading plugins from directory 'plugin.samples'", 'ip': '10.30.62.101', 'request_id': 'c5ce833c05e8efa690ab36ba5e1adafc', 'user_id': 1, 'timestamp': '2025-11-27T00:46:24.864079Z', 'logger': 'inventree', 'level': 'debug'}
2025-11-27T00:46:24.940621Z [debug ] Loading plugins from directory 'plugin.samples' [inventree] ip=10.30.62.101 request_id=5cbc2ce19d1431b02a83262ba6817da5 user_id=1
2025-11-26 16:46:24,940 DEBUG {'event': "Loading plugins from directory 'plugin.samples'", 'ip': '10.30.62.101', 'user_id': 1, 'request_id': '5cbc2ce19d1431b02a83262ba6817da5', 'timestamp': '2025-11-27T00:46:24.940621Z', 'logger': 'inventree', 'level': 'debug'}
2025-11-27T00:46:24.943813Z [debug ] Loading plugins from directory 'plugins' [inventree] ip=10.30.62.101 request_id=c5ce833c05e8efa690ab36ba5e1adafc user_id=1
2025-11-26 16:46:24,943 DEBUG {'event': "Loading plugins from directory 'plugins'", 'ip': '10.30.62.101', 'request_id': 'c5ce833c05e8efa690ab36ba5e1adafc', 'user_id': 1, 'timestamp': '2025-11-27T00:46:24.943813Z', 'logger': 'inventree', 'level': 'debug'}
2025-11-27T00:46:24.944299Z [debug ] Loading plugins from directory '/home/inventree/data/plugins' [inventree] ip=10.30.62.101 request_id=c5ce833c05e8efa690ab36ba5e1adafc user_id=1
2025-11-26 16:46:24,944 DEBUG {'event': "Loading plugins from directory '/home/inventree/data/plugins'", 'ip': '10.30.62.101', 'request_id': 'c5ce833c05e8efa690ab36ba5e1adafc', 'user_id': 1, 'timestamp': '2025-11-27T00:46:24.944299Z', 'logger': 'inventree', 'level': 'debug'}
2025-11-27T00:46:24.952577Z [info ] Collected 42 plugins [inventree] ip=10.30.62.101 request_id=c5ce833c05e8efa690ab36ba5e1adafc user_id=1
2025-11-26 16:46:24,952 INFO {'event': 'Collected 42 plugins', 'ip': '10.30.62.101', 'request_id': 'c5ce833c05e8efa690ab36ba5e1adafc', 'user_id': 1, 'timestamp': '2025-11-27T00:46:24.952577Z', 'logger': 'inventree', 'level': 'info'}
2025-11-27T00:46:24.953026Z [debug ] barcodes.inventree_barcode, events.auto_create_builds, events.auto_issue_orders, exporter.bom_exporter, exporter.inventree_exporter, exporter.part_parameter_exporter, exporter.stocktake_exporter, integration.core_notifications, integration.core_notifications, integration.core_notifications, integration.currency_exchange, integration.machine_types, integration.part_notifications, labels.inventree_label, labels.inventree_machine, labels.label_sheet, suppliers.digikey, suppliers.lcsc, suppliers.mouser, suppliers.tme, event.event_sample, event.filtered_event_sample, icons.icon_sample, integration.another_sample, integration.another_sample, integration.api_caller, integration.label_sample, integration.report_plugin_sample, integration.sample, integration.sample_currency_exchange, integration.scheduled_task, integration.simpleactionplugin, plugin.samples.integration.simpleactionplugin, integration.transition, integration.transition, integration.user_interface_sample, integration.validation_sample, integration.version, locate.locate_sample, machines.sample_printer, mail.mail_sample, supplier.supplier_sample [inventree] ip=10.30.62.101 request_id=c5ce833c05e8efa690ab36ba5e1adafc user_id=1
2025-11-26 16:46:24,953 DEBUG {'event': 'barcodes.inventree_barcode, events.auto_create_builds, events.auto_issue_orders, exporter.bom_exporter, exporter.inventree_exporter, exporter.part_parameter_exporter, exporter.stocktake_exporter, integration.core_notifications, integration.core_notifications, integration.core_notifications, integration.currency_exchange, integration.machine_types, integration.part_notifications, labels.inventree_label, labels.inventree_machine, labels.label_sheet, suppliers.digikey, suppliers.lcsc, suppliers.mouser, suppliers.tme, event.event_sample, event.filtered_event_sample, icons.icon_sample, integration.another_sample, integration.another_sample, integration.api_caller, integration.label_sample, integration.report_plugin_sample, integration.sample, integration.sample_currency_exchange, integration.scheduled_task, integration.simpleactionplugin, plugin.samples.integration.simpleactionplugin, integration.transition, integration.transition, integration.user_interface_sample, integration.validation_sample, integration.version, locate.locate_sample, machines.sample_printer, mail.mail_sample, supplier.supplier_sample', 'ip': '10.30.62.101', 'request_id': 'c5ce833c05e8efa690ab36ba5e1adafc', 'user_id': 1, 'timestamp': '2025-11-27T00:46:24.953026Z', 'logger': 'inventree', 'level': 'debug'}
2025-11-27T00:46:24.953328Z [info ] Start unloading plugins [inventree] ip=10.30.62.101 request_id=c5ce833c05e8efa690ab36ba5e1adafc user_id=1
2025-11-26 16:46:24,953 INFO {'event': 'Start unloading plugins', 'ip': '10.30.62.101', 'request_id': 'c5ce833c05e8efa690ab36ba5e1adafc', 'user_id': 1, 'timestamp': '2025-11-27T00:46:24.953328Z', 'logger': 'inventree', 'level': 'info'}
2025-11-27T00:46:24.958743Z [info ] Loading InvenTree plugins [inventree] ip=10.30.62.101 request_id=c5ce833c05e8efa690ab36ba5e1adafc user_id=1
2025-11-26 16:46:24,958 INFO {'event': 'Loading InvenTree plugins', 'ip': '10.30.62.101', 'request_id': 'c5ce833c05e8efa690ab36ba5e1adafc', 'user_id': 1, 'timestamp': '2025-11-27T00:46:24.958743Z', 'logger': 'inventree', 'level': 'info'}
2025-11-27T00:46:24.960163Z [debug ] Machine app: Skipping machine loading sequence [inventree] ip=10.30.62.101 request_id=c5ce833c05e8efa690ab36ba5e1adafc user_id=1
2025-11-26 16:46:24,960 DEBUG {'event': 'Machine app: Skipping machine loading sequence', 'ip': '10.30.62.101', 'request_id': 'c5ce833c05e8efa690ab36ba5e1adafc', 'user_id': 1, 'timestamp': '2025-11-27T00:46:24.960163Z', 'logger': 'inventree', 'level': 'debug'}
2025-11-27T00:46:24.962257Z [debug ] Loading plugins from directory 'plugins' [inventree] ip=10.30.62.101 request_id=5cbc2ce19d1431b02a83262ba6817da5 user_id=1
2025-11-26 16:46:24,962 DEBUG {'event': "Loading plugins from directory 'plugins'", 'ip': '10.30.62.101', 'user_id': 1, 'request_id': '5cbc2ce19d1431b02a83262ba6817da5', 'timestamp': '2025-11-27T00:46:24.962257Z', 'logger': 'inventree', 'level': 'debug'}
2025-11-27T00:46:24.962688Z [debug ] Loading plugins from directory '/home/inventree/data/plugins' [inventree] ip=10.30.62.101 request_id=5cbc2ce19d1431b02a83262ba6817da5 user_id=1
2025-11-26 16:46:24,962 DEBUG {'event': "Loading plugins from directory '/home/inventree/data/plugins'", 'ip': '10.30.62.101', 'user_id': 1, 'request_id': '5cbc2ce19d1431b02a83262ba6817da5', 'timestamp': '2025-11-27T00:46:24.962688Z', 'logger': 'inventree', 'level': 'debug'}
2025-11-27T00:46:25.035339Z [debug ] Deactivating plugin settings [inventree] ip=10.30.62.101 request_id=c5ce833c05e8efa690ab36ba5e1adafc user_id=1
2025-11-26 16:46:25,035 DEBUG {'event': 'Deactivating plugin settings', 'ip': '10.30.62.101', 'request_id': 'c5ce833c05e8efa690ab36ba5e1adafc', 'user_id': 1, 'timestamp': '2025-11-27T00:46:25.035339Z', 'logger': 'inventree', 'level': 'debug'}
2025-11-27T00:46:25.035682Z [debug ] Finished deactivating plugins [inventree] ip=10.30.62.101 request_id=c5ce833c05e8efa690ab36ba5e1adafc user_id=1
2025-11-26 16:46:25,035 DEBUG {'event': 'Finished deactivating plugins', 'ip': '10.30.62.101', 'request_id': 'c5ce833c05e8efa690ab36ba5e1adafc', 'user_id': 1, 'timestamp': '2025-11-27T00:46:25.035682Z', 'logger': 'inventree', 'level': 'debug'}
2025-11-27T00:46:25.035962Z [info ] Finished unloading plugins [inventree] ip=10.30.62.101 request_id=c5ce833c05e8efa690ab36ba5e1adafc user_id=1
2025-11-26 16:46:25,035 INFO {'event': 'Finished unloading plugins', 'ip': '10.30.62.101', 'request_id': 'c5ce833c05e8efa690ab36ba5e1adafc', 'user_id': 1, 'timestamp': '2025-11-27T00:46:25.035962Z', 'logger': 'inventree', 'level': 'info'}
2025-11-27T00:46:25.036209Z [info ] Loading plugins [inventree] ip=10.30.62.101 request_id=c5ce833c05e8efa690ab36ba5e1adafc user_id=1
2025-11-26 16:46:25,036 INFO {'event': 'Loading plugins', 'ip': '10.30.62.101', 'request_id': 'c5ce833c05e8efa690ab36ba5e1adafc', 'user_id': 1, 'timestamp': '2025-11-27T00:46:25.036209Z', 'logger': 'inventree', 'level': 'info'}
Beta Was this translation helpful? Give feedback.
All reactions